Currently one may detect that trigger is INactive only by extracting its content. Command `show trigger' does not display such info neither in 2.5 nor in 3.0:

SQL> show trigger;
Trigger name Invalid
================================ =======
TRG_CONNECT

Table name Trigger name Invalid
================================ ================================ =======
AGENTS AGENTS_BI
DOC_LIST DOC_LIST_AIUD
DOC_LIST DOC_LIST_BIUD
. . .
SQL> show trigger trg_connect;
TRG_CONNECT, Sequence: 0, Type: ON CONNECT, Inactive
Trigger text:

as
begin
execute procedure sp_init_ctx;
. . . .
end

It will be useful to add information about INactive trigger(s) to the output of SHOW TRIGGER command.
